What is Ghost Betting?
Ghost betting refers to a shadowy practice in the online gambling industry where bets are placed on fictitious or manipulated events, often through unregulated platforms. These ‘ghost’ games or matches don’t actually exist or are rigged to deceive participants. The term has gained traction with the rise of digital betting sites, where anonymity and lack of oversight can lead to exploitative schemes.
At its core, ghost betting exploits the excitement of sports betting, esports, or casino games by creating illusions of real opportunities. For instance, scammers might promote bets on non-existent soccer matches or virtual races, luring users with promises of high returns. This practice isn’t just unethical; it often borders on fraud, leading to significant financial losses for unsuspecting bettors.

The Risks Involved in Ghost Betting
Engaging in ghost betting carries multifaceted risks that extend beyond financial loss. Primarily, there’s the danger of monetary fraud, where bettors deposit funds into sham accounts, only to never see returns or even recover their initial investment. This can lead to severe financial strain, especially for those betting large sums.
Additionally, privacy and security are major concerns. Ghost betting sites often lack proper encryption, exposing users’ personal and financial data to hackers. Identity theft and data breaches are common fallout, compounding the damage.
On a psychological level, the allure of quick wins can foster addictive behaviors. Expert insights suggest that the deceptive nature of ghost betting preys on cognitive biases, making it harder for individuals to recognize red flags. Legal risks also loom large, as participating in unregulated betting can violate gambling laws in many jurisdictions, potentially leading to fines or other penalties.

How to Identify and Avoid Ghost Betting Scams
Knowledge is your best defense against ghost betting. Start by verifying the legitimacy of any betting platform. Look for licenses from recognized authorities and read user reviews on trusted forums. Avoid sites that promise guaranteed wins or lack transparent terms.
Practical tips include using secure payment methods, setting betting limits, and educating yourself on common scam tactics. For example, if a site demands upfront fees for ‘exclusive’ ghost betting tips, it’s likely a fraud. Always cross-check event details with official sources before placing bets.
